mz-s Posted January 23 #15 Share Posted January 23 On 1/18/2024 at 7:26 AM, shof515 said: i agree. the gold drink benefit is soo much better then the limited brunch platinum drink benefit. why are platinum restricted to where you can get a drink and not gold members? The seaday brunch drink was added to Platinum and Diamond back when seaday brunch was first instituted years ago. Gold never got anything like this. Recall that originally, Gold was included in the past guest party. When they were eliminated from the party, they were given the free drink on the last evening of the cruise as a consolation. 4 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

DallasGuy75219 Posted January 24 #17 Share Posted January 24 On 1/23/2024 at 2:42 PM, Crusin Karen said: I did not know there was a limit. I know they charged me $2.30 which I assumed was the gratuity. I ordered a Bloody Caesar. If it was $13 (not sure how much it is) the 18% would be $2.34. Still a good deal! But if it’s free it should be free IMO. 🤷♀️ The terms and conditions of the VIFP program state, "One (1) complimentary specialty coffee, soda or alcoholic beverage with a value no greater than $10.00 + gratuity at Seaday Brunch." So your $2.30 charge was the $1.95 overage on an $11.95 drink plus 18% gratuity on that overage. 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
